Corporate Social Value Statement

Global pharmaceutical provider Tanner Pharma was founded in 2002, and its core purpose is to improve lives by increasing access to medicines around the world. Tanner ensures its people and partners are exceptional at what they do and are inspired to go above and beyond. Tanner relentlessly pursues and delivers innovative solutions that enable access to essential therapies for patients in need.

Tanner builds Corporate Social Responsibility into its everyday business and is committed to incorporating Environmental, Social and Governance (ESG) into every area of its operations.

Tanner Pharma has recently published its first Carbon Footprint and Carbon Reduction Plan for the Tanner global business. Measures are being taken across the business and within its supply chain to reduce these emissions. Transport, packaging, waste, energy usage, water consumption and recycling are all focus areas for Tanner.

 Tanner Pharma Group Inc. encourages its employees to dedicate company-paid time to volunteer for worthy causes. Employees donate their time to a variety of charities in each office location ensuring that they benefit their local communities. Each year a percentage of Tanner’s profits is donated to worthy causes across the globe. To date, the company has awarded financial and material donations to more than 150 nonprofit organizations and educational institutions.

Tanner Pharma Group gives every employee 24/7/365 wellbeing support via our partner Finu, which allows them confidential access to trained therapists, online support and helplines.
